Ford has been closing Plants in North America for years and building all over the world.

I just counted Ford plants on Wikipedia
91 foreign plants (includes 3 in Canada) (closed 4 in Canada in last three years)
29 US plants

And Ford is the in better shape of the Big three because of closing 14 plants in the US in the last two years.
